How much do android developer jobs pay per hour?

As of Jul 23, 2026, the average hourly pay for android developer in Apollo Beach, FL is $59.10, according to ZipRecruiter salary data. Most workers in this role earn between $51.83 and $68.08 per hour, depending on experience, location, and employer.

What are Android Developers?

Android Developers are software professionals who design, build, and maintain applications for devices running the Android operating system. They use programming languages such as Java or Kotlin and work with Android Studio, the official integrated development environment. Android Developers are responsible for creating user-friendly, secure, and efficient mobile apps, often collaborating with designers and other engineers to deliver high-quality experiences. Their work can range from building simple utilities to complex applications for smartphones, tablets, or wearable devices.

How do Android Developers typically collaborate with designers and product managers during the app development process?

Android Developers often work closely with designers to ensure that app interfaces are both visually appealing and technically feasible. They participate in regular meetings with product managers to clarify requirements, discuss project timelines, and prioritize features. Collaboration tools such as Jira, Figma, and Slack are commonly used to facilitate communication and feedback loops. This teamwork helps ensure that the final product aligns with both user expectations and business objectives.

What Do Android Developers Do?

As an Android developer, your responsibilities and duties vary, depending on your position and the size of your team. You may be involved in the planning stage, aggregating requirements for the app, and planning how it will be developed. You may be part of the coding team that writes the program. Some developers work on the testing phase before the app is launched, and others work on patches to fix bugs as they are discovered. Coding updates and seeing them through to release is often a long-term and ongoing aspect of Android development. If you work independently or for a small firm, you may be involved in all phases of the development life cycle, whereas those employed by larger firms likely have specialized roles.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ive as an Android Developer, and why are they important?

To thrive as an Android Developer, you need strong proficiency in Java or Kotlin, experience with Android SDK, and a solid understanding of mobile app architecture, typically supported by a degree in computer science or related fields. Familiarity with tools such as Android Studio, version control systems like Git, and knowledge of APIs and libraries is also essential. Creative problem-solving, attention to detail, and effective communication help developers deliver robust apps and collaborate well with teams. These skills and qualities are crucial for building high-quality, user-friendly applications that meet both technical and business requirements.

Will AI replace Android developers?

AI is unlikely to fully replace Android developers, as the role requires creativity, problem-solving, and understanding user needs that AI cannot replicate. Instead, AI tools can assist developers by automating routine tasks and improving efficiency, allowing developers to focus on complex aspects of app design and functionality. Staying updated with programming languages like Kotlin and mastering development environments remains essential for Android developers.
